About This Song

The yawning. The eye rubbing. The absolute insistence that they are NOT tired. “I’m Not Tired!” is every bedtime negotiation set to a beat — the snack requests, the TV demands, the Bluey bargaining. And then the line that every parent feels in their bones: “My voice will be heard around the nation, because I lack emotional regulation.”

This family hip hop bedtime anthem is for toddlers and preschoolers who fight sleep like it’s their job. If your house turns into a tiny protest rally every night around 7:30, this track will make you laugh instead of cry. Pajamas have never been so controversial!
